| Description : |
Tumor necrosis factor receptor superfamily member 4 (TNFRSF4) is also known as ACT35 antigen, OX40L receptor, TAX transcriptionally-activated glycoprotein 1 receptor, CD antigen CD134, OX40. OX40/TNFRSF4 contains four TNFR-Cys repeats. TNFRSF4 is receptor for TNFSF4/OX40L/GP34 and can interacts with TRAF2, TRAF3 and TRAF5. |
